FTNT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review

592 of the 4,538 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fortinet (FTNT)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$12B — down 8.7% from $13.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 95 funds closed out of FTNT and 70 opened new positions — a net loss of 25 holders — while 238 trimmed existing stakes and 195 added.

The largest buyer was Whale Rock Capital Management, adding an estimated $100M. The largest seller was Two Sigma Investments, cutting an estimated $128M.
